Cleaning
Top Cover
Refer to the top cover wash tag for cleaning instructions.
If there are visible signs of body fluids and or substances present, the top cover should be washed. Top covers can be machine
washed (up to 80ºC) using authorised cleaning and disinfection solutions.
To establish the amount of disinfectant to use, determine the amount of water in the washer and then follow the manufacturers’
instructions for dilution.
Soak the top cover in the disinfectant during the wash cycle. Rinse well in clean water and dry thoroughly before use.
Do not dry the top cover using too high a heat cycle (see Dartex technical recommendations - up to 80ºC ). Air dry if possible or
select an appropriate heat dry cycle within limits as above. If there are no visible signs of body fluids and or substances on the top
cover, the top cover should be sanitized and rinsed with fresh water accordingly.
If there are no visible signs of body fluids and or substances on the top cover, the top cover should be sanitized.
1. Apply an intermediate level authorised cleaning and disinfection solution to the top cover upper surface either by spraying or by
hand application.
2. Ensure the surface is completely covered with the disinfectant and remains in contact with the surface according to
manufacturer’s instructions.
3. Remove disinfectant and rinse thoroughly.
4. Allow to air dry before use.
Handle
The exterior of the Handle can be periodically wiped using a cloth and dampened with authorised cleaning and disinfection
solutions.
Control Unit
Ensure the Control Unit is disconnected from the mains electricity supply before cleaning.
Do not spray disinfectant directly on to the Control Unit, or immerse the Control Unit in any type of liquid. This could result in a
severe electrical hazard as this equipment has no protection against ingress of water.
This equipment is not suitable for use in the presence of a flammable anaesthetic mixture with air or with oxygen or nitrous
oxide.
Wipe down Control Unit with warm water containing detergent (or authorised cleaning and disinfection solution) and dry thoroughly
before use.
In case of notifiable diseases clean and disinfect systems following eventually special procedures revised and published by the
local health care authorities. The transport should take place in special plastic bags only.
